JTL Auftragsimportdatei aus CSV Auftragsdatei erstellen (idealo)



Vorlage zum Erstellen einer JTL CSV Auftragsdatei am Beispiel von idealo DIREKTKAUF Aufträgen


Diese Vorlage zeigt am Beispiel von idealo DIREKKAUF, wie aus einer idealo DIREKKAUF Auftragsdatei eine CSV Auftragsdatei zum Import in JTL erzeugt wird.
In JTL können die Aufträge über die JTL-Ameise manuell oder automatisiert (via FTP) importiert werden.

Hiweis zur verwendeten idealo DIREKKAUF Auftragsdatei:
Die Auftragsdatei ist eine Demodatei mit Testdaten und liegt auf unserem Synesty Demoserver. Ein idealo Zugang ist zum Ausprobieren dieser Vorlage deshalb nicht notwendig.

Quelle ändern:
In diesem Flow wird per URLDownload eine Beispiel CSV idealo DIREKTKAUF Auftragsdatei vom Synesty Demoserver heruntergeladen und mit dem Step SpreadsheetCSVReader verarbeitet. Die Steps URLDownload und SpreadsheetCSVReader können durch den Step idealoGetOrders ersetzt werden, um Auftragsdaten von idealo DIREKTKAUF zu holen. In diesem Fall brauchen Sie dann Zugangsdaten von idealo.
Statt der CSV idealo DIREKTKAUF Auftragsdatei können auch andere Dateien (CSV,XML,JSON) in Synesty importiert und als JTL Auftragsdatei ausgegeben werden.

Auftragsdatenstruktur ändern und erweitern:
Der eigentlich Aufbau der Auftragsdatei findet im SpreadsheetMapper statt. Die im SpreadsheetMappper erzeugten Daten und Logiken können individuell angepasst werden. Weitere Informationen zum SpreadsheetMapper finden Sie in unserem Benutzerhandbuch unter https://docs.synesty.com/display/SSUD/SpreadsheetMapper

Erzeugte Datei verwenden:
Die erzeugte Datei kann entweder in der Vorschau des des Steps JTLcreateOrderFile heruntergeladen werden oder man erweitert den Flow und lässt sich die Datei z.B. per e-mail senden oder legt diese auf den eigenen FTP ab.

Import in JTL:
Die erzeugte CSV Datei mit den Aufträgen kann mit der JTL Ameise importiert werden. Beim Import über die JTL Ameise muss keine Feldzuordnung (Mapping) vorgenommen werden, da die Spaltennamen in der CSV Datei bereits den Spaltennamen in JTL entsprechen. Beachten Sie beim Import, dass Datei Encoding UTF-8 ausgewählt sein muss. Weitere Informationen zum Auftragsimport in JTL finden Sie unter https://guide.jtl-software.de/Auftr%C3%A4ge_mit_JTL-Ameise_importieren


Installiert folgende Komponenten:
  • 1 Projekt mit Beispielflows, welche Sie an Ihre Anforderungen anpassen können.
Registrieren und diese Vorlage nutzen

Flows

Hier sehen Sie eine Vorschau der Flows, die mit dieser Vorlage installiert werden.

JTLcreateOrderImportFile-idealo CSV Datei verarbeiten

UrlDownload

SpreadsheetCSVReader

JTLcreateOrderImportFile